@@ -422,7 +422,6 @@ fn macro_def(db: &dyn DefDatabase, id: MacroId) -> MacroDefId {
422422 let makro = & item_tree[ loc. id . value ] ;
423423 MacroDefId {
424424 krate : loc. container . krate ,
425- block : loc. container . block . map ( |block| salsa:: plumbing:: AsId :: as_id ( & block) ) ,
426425 kind : kind ( loc. expander , loc. id . file_id ( ) , makro. ast_id . upcast ( ) ) ,
427426 local_inner : false ,
428427 allow_internal_unsafe : loc. allow_internal_unsafe ,
@@ -436,7 +435,6 @@ fn macro_def(db: &dyn DefDatabase, id: MacroId) -> MacroDefId {
436435 let makro = & item_tree[ loc. id . value ] ;
437436 MacroDefId {
438437 krate : loc. container . krate ,
439- block : loc. container . block . map ( |block| salsa:: plumbing:: AsId :: as_id ( & block) ) ,
440438 kind : kind ( loc. expander , loc. id . file_id ( ) , makro. ast_id . upcast ( ) ) ,
441439 local_inner : loc. flags . contains ( MacroRulesLocFlags :: LOCAL_INNER ) ,
442440 allow_internal_unsafe : loc
@@ -452,7 +450,6 @@ fn macro_def(db: &dyn DefDatabase, id: MacroId) -> MacroDefId {
452450 let makro = & item_tree[ loc. id . value ] ;
453451 MacroDefId {
454452 krate : loc. container . krate ,
455- block : None ,
456453 kind : MacroDefKind :: ProcMacro (
457454 InFile :: new ( loc. id . file_id ( ) , makro. ast_id ) ,
458455 loc. expander ,
0 commit comments